Thank you for your interest in staying with us during your stay.** Anderson Park is located in the heart of Vernonia at the confluence of the Nehalem River and Rock Creek. You'll be just a short walk from downtown shopping and restaurants. The Banks-Vernonia State Trail borders the park and provides access to Vernonia Lake. The park offers 19 full hookups (30 or 50 amp) RV sites, 12 tent sites and horse camping. Amenities include free Wi-Fi, full restroom facility, covered picnic area, playground, bike repair station, boat ramp and horse arena. Our Covered Picnic Shelter is available to rent in 4-hour increments. The cost is $50 for 4 hours. Call the campground to check availability. This includes a kitchen counter/sink prep area, 2 electrical outlets, and 5 picnic tables. Whether it's for a short and or long-term stay, we hope to welcome you soon!

Yakima River RV Park is located near Ellensburg, Washington. It features 36 campsites that are big rig friendly. 32 of them are pull through full service sites, and 4 are back-in power water only sites. We also offer 9 rv/tent back-in dry sites. The park provides free WiFi, and is pet-friendly. Check-in time is after 1:00 pm, and before 6:00 pm, Late check-in or check-out can be made by prior arrangement for an additional fee. Visitors are welcome, but must register at office, or by prior arrangement, as a day parking pass is required. We value our all guests right to an enjoyable camping experience, and ask everyone to respect other campers right to do so. Loud music and /or gatherings are strongly discouraged. There is a 10:00 pm quiet time that requires all outdoor music and gatherings to be taken inside in order to allow those that want to sleep to do so, and to preserve the quiet outdoor atmosphere for those that just wish to sit by the fire and enjoy the night air.  We thank all the customers over the past years for making the Yakima River RV Park a place where all are welcome, and for making this a sucessfull place of peace and enjoyment.   Amenities & Activities Park offerings include, horse stalls, picnic tables, fire rings. Visitors can also enjoy activities such as volleyball, horseshoes, hiking and biking. Yakima River offers fishing, kayaking, and canoeing. For fishermen, check regulations for restrictions.   Attractions Barn quilt trail, Wild Horse Wind Farm observatory, local wineries and wine tasting, Scenic Yakima Canyon bighorn sheep heard and wildlife viewing.  The campground is near attractions like: Barn Quilt Trail Wild Horse Wind Solar Observatory Thorpe Mill

Quiet and peaceful yet only 45 minutes from Portland, Tucked Away Retreat is located on 4 private acres, making it the perfect spot for a peaceful getaway where one may enjoy watching the deer wander through the property or the hawks float overhead. Bring your bikes and hit the Crown Zellerbach trail, or hike it instead, as we are conveniently located approximately 0.8 miles from the trail. Visit Sauvie's Island, one of the largest inland islands in the United States, paddle or kayak on Scappoose Bay, head up to the Trojan frisbee-golf course, Veronica, the Nehalem River, Big Eddy Park or simply relax on the lawn. We offer two sites; Site A is on flat gravel that enjoys morning shade and full afternoon sun while sitting adjacent to the power and water source (pump house). Site A is across from the large grassy area perfect for sunning and relaxing while also accommodating larger trailers and/or motor homes. Site B is on gravel on the upper drive and is shaded most of the day, best suited for camper vans, truck campers or small trailers due to trees along the tight back curve of the driveway. Site B has several spots to park; either on the gravel drive or on packed dirt while being backed by a small shop. The two sites are separated by trees. The property can accommodate one or two additional RV's in spots adjacent to both sites for multiple vehicle groups; contact us for more information if you are a larger group. Please be aware that we are RV only, we have no outhouse, so we cannot accommodate tents or folks who want to sleep in their vehicle. Note: we live next door and are currently finishing a tiny house. For Site A, you may position your RV to view the grassy area and not the tiny house. Whether its for a short and or long term stay, we hope to see you soon!
